It will demonstrate how failover works and the importance of using proper addresses in tnsnames. Oracle database 11g with oracle rac and oracle grid infrastructure enterprise edition 11. Oracle rac one node is a single instance of an oracle racenabled database running on one node in a cluster. If failure occurs during a transaction, the database rolls back the transaction, taf notifies the client to clean up application state by issuing. Switchover, failover physical standby database oracle. To enable oracle rac failover to work with build forge, there is additional configuration required. Rac has also been enhanced to work with oracles transparent application failover taf to automatically restart any connections when an instance fails.
Fast start failover is a feature available through oracle dataguard broker which performs an automatic failover to the chosen standby database in case of a primary database crash. Transparent application failover for rac rajat dbas. Oracle rac allows a single physical oracle database to be accessed by concurrent instances of oracle running across several different cpus. Download oracle database 11g oracle real application. This blog posting is about protecting an instance from a 10. In this article we are going to performing the oracle 11gr2 two node rac to.
Data guard physical standby single instance or rac withwithout broker. Real application clusters the rac architecture allows many instances to share a single database, but it avoids the overhead of ram block pinging. This provides the highest levels of availability and the most flexible scalability. Automatic workload management with oracle real application clusters 11g release 27 and the oracle real application clusters administration and deployment guide8. Hi experts, i want to create oracle 11g r2 rac failover active passive on solaris 10 2 node clusters please share the steps or documents. Pdf pro oracle database 11g rac on linux, 2nd edition by martin bach, steve shaw, oracle. Oracle rac database has become unavailable but the application tier at the. Oracle rac is a cluster database with a shared cache architecture that overcomes the limitations of traditional sharednothing and shareddisk approaches to provide highly scalable and available database solutions for all your business applications. Performing database failover with oracle 11g data guard. Find out how to prepare your hardware, deploy oracle real application clusters, optimize data integrity, and integrate seamless failover protection. Oracle database with real application clusters and oracle clusterware provide. Oracle rac also is a key part of the oracle 10g release. This article the sixth in this ongoing series explores how to manually fail over.
Deploying the bigip ltm for oracle database and rac deployment guide version 1. From wikibooks, open books for an open world exit disconnected from oracle database 11g enterprise edition release 11. Following a data guard failover manual or faststart failover, data guard. Clusters 11g release 22, and the oracle real application clusters. This site is like a library, use search box in the widget to get ebook that you want. With scan, you configure the jdbc url so that scan selects the initial node and fails over to the other available node. Grid computing relieves users from concerns about where data resides and which computer processes their requests.
All the commands in this blog has been tested in test environment only,so please run and test these commands in your test environment before running it. Oracle database 11g release 2 grid infrastructure 11. Real application clusters, commonly abbreviated as rac, is oracles industryleading architecture for scalable and faulttolerant databases. Have collected the rac failover test cases from various sources and modified a bit, attached here in with categorical wise which may be useful to you all when some one ask you about to do testing of rac new environment. When either a manual or automatic database failover is initiated, the standby database.
Oracle rac provides failover with the node vip addresses by configuring multiple listeners on multiple nodes to manage client connection requests for the same database service. Using oracle real application clusters rac for high. Configure physical standby database oracle database 12c release 1 12. When a client issues a connection request using scan, the three scan addresses are returned to the client. When a node failure occurs, connection attempts can fail over to other nodes in the cluster, which assume the work of the failed node. In this section of the oracle dba tutorial, you will get to know about real application clusters rac, clustering with rac, advantages of oracle rac, configuring, deploying, and testing rac, primary and standby databases, and automatic storage management in oracle rac. This section describes oracle database 12c configuration best practices to automatically transition application connections from a failed primary database to a new primary database after a data guard active data guard role transition has occurred. Let us consider, we have primary site with two node rac and standby site also configured with two node rac in 11gr2. Using traditional rac in sterling b2b integrator, you configure the jdbc url to name an initial node and a failover node. Pdf load balancing in oracle database real application cluster. Select failover replays queries that were in progress. Oracle white paper oracle real application clusters 11g release 2 introduction oracle real application clusters rac allows oracle database to run any packaged or custom application, unchanged across a server pool.
We are using an oracle 12c database and a postgresql edb 9. Pdf pro oracle database 11g rac on linux, 2nd edition. Read online oracle real application clusters rac 11g release 2 book pdf free download link book now. When considering the availability of the oracle database, oracle rac 11g provides a superior solution with its advanced failover mechanisms. Download pro oracle database 11g rac on linux experts. Oracle white paperapplication failover with oracle database 11g. Oracle database 11g oracle real application clusters handbook, second edition has been fully revised and updated to cover the latest tools and features. Oracle rac is composed of two or more database instances. Minimal downtime maintenance, upgrades, migrations. Rac attack oracle cluster database at homeconnection. Fsfo involves an observer component which runs on a different machine than that of the primary and the standby database. New application failover features in oracle database 11g release 2. Please see the following for details on this framework.
We also have a rman backup script that works fine, using a recovery catalog database which is located in a town 20km from the data center. Oracle rac 11g includes the required components that all work within a clustered configuration responsible for providing continuous availability. Client failover best practices for highly available oracle. Cold failover for a single instance rac database oracle. An oracle rac system is composed of a group of independent servers, or nodes, that cooperate as a single system as shown in figure 1. Oracle database online documentation 11g release 2 11.
Pro oracle database 11g rac on linux provides fulllifecycle guidance on implementing oracle real application clusters in a linux environment. Pro oracle database 11g rac on linux julian dyke apress. This section describes oracle database 12c configuration best practices to automatically transition application connections from a failed primary database to a new primary database after a data guard. The underlying database has oracle database 11g real application clusters oracle rac capability or oracle restart for single instance databases.
I talked with some of my friends about how to make the application failover smoothly, the answer is taf. With oracle database 11g release 2, oracle introduced rac one node. According to oracle database licensing information 11gr2. Manual failover,failover,physical standby,standby database.
Data guards capability to recover a missioncritical database upon the loss of the entire production site is at the heart of oracle 11gs disaster recovery features. Oracle database failover cluster with grid infrastructure 11g. Oracle real application clusters rac 11g release 2 pdf. I want to refer to the great document using oracle clusterware to protect a single instance oracle database 11g written by my collegue philip newlan since most input comes from here. They are composed of memory structures and background processes same as the single instance database. The java virtual machine jvm in which your jdbc instance is running must have. As a result, the application may continue fetching after a failure occurs. In case of worst situation with data guard primary database, or not available for production than we can activated standby database as a primary production database.
Cache fusion is the key memory feature that enables oracle rac performance, and the new transparent application failover taf is what applications use to sync up with oracle rac availability. It is a clustering solution from oracle corporation that ensures high availability of databases by providing instance failover, media failover features. This article describes the installation of oracle database 11g release 2 11. Oracle weblogic server integration with oracle database.
When it is used, all nodes in the cluster are made eligible for failover. Download oracle real application clusters rac 11g release 2 book pdf free download link or read online here in pdf. Scan single client access name is a facility in oracle 11g. Available beginning in oracle rac 11g r2, scan allows you to set up rac failover without specifying nodes. Oracle 11g physical standby data guard failover steps. Pro oracle database 11g rac on linux supplies fulllifecycle steerage on implementing oracle actual software clusters in a linux setting. Oracle rac failover not working correctly database. Implementation of oracle real application cluster iieta. Oracle 11g r2 rac failover documents oracle community.
The script for database backup works fine, and is started from crontab job or from oracle dbconsole for now it. Application failover with oracle database 11g compendium. Client failover best practices for highly available oracle databases. Real application cluster rac taf support what it is. In fact according to oracle documentation restoration of voting disks that were copied using the dd or cp command may prevent your clusterware from starting up.
Step by step oracle 11gr2 rac standby database manual failover. Grid naming service gns introduced in oracle rac 11g r2. This lab was written for oracle 11gr1 and the information here is crucial when working with this and older versions. Seamless application failover with data guard oracle. Deploying the bigip ltm for oracle database and rac. Definitions differences oracle 10g r2, 11g r1, 11g r2 new features in 11g r2 rac terms terminology in 11g r2 rac 11g r2 rac architecture clusterware scripts asm concepts asm architecture asm sample scripts.
For the dba, the grid is about resource allocation, information sharing, and high availability. Transparent application failover taf is a protocol within oracle whereby, if a connection to a database node fails, it can be reestablished against an alternative node. Oracle white paperapplication failover with oracle database 11g 3 execute the query and reposition the cursor. Users request information or computation and have it delivered as much as they want, whenever they want. Oracle database oracle clusterware and oracle real. Transparent application failover taf is what applications use to sync up with oracle rac availability. Oracle database 11g oracle active data guard oracle.
Will oracle rac, on its own, be aware of failures on the servers at a os fiesystem level. While the content in this guide is still valid for the products and versions listed in the document, it is no longer being updated and may refer to f5 or third party products or versions that have reached endofl\. Taf in the database reroutes application clients to an available database node in the cluster when the connected node fails. This article explores the cooperation between oracle rac, cache fusion, and taf and offers insights into the architecture and use of these tools for. Configure on feb 4, 2019 many dbas may never pay attentions on this topic.
The observer hardly consumes any resource and requires. In this article we are going to performing the oracle 11gr2 two node rac to rac manual failover steps to a physical standby database. This article presents switchover and failover methods available for physical standby database in oracle database 12c release 1 this article is based on following article. However, starting with 11gr2 the node vips should not be used to connect to the database the scan vip should always be used instead. Oracle database 11g release 2 rac on oracle linux 5. Oracle notification service ons is configured and available on the node where jdbc is running. This provides continuous, uninterrupted data access. We plan to use oracle rac 11g for failover with 2 sun fire v890s and a storagetek 6140 storage. Real application clusters rac oracle rac dba tutorial. Oracle white paperoracle real application clusters 11g release 2 introduction oracle real application clusters rac allows oracle database to run any packaged or custom application, unchanged across a server pool. Click download or read online button to get expert oracle rac 12c book now. Rac provides nearcontinuous availability by hiding failures from enduser clients and application server clients. All books are in clear copy here, and all files are secure so dont worry about it. If i have scan and if my client connects to my database using then scan will ensure connect time failoverctf meaning, if a connection is trying to establish with a node and of it fails, scan will try connecting to another available node and that is connect time failover and also connect time failover does not require any service to be.
53 1062 805 1329 35 1570 370 362 1352 602 187 51 528 121 529 1612 97 1335 210 707 79 1643 428 700 1625 739 779 1090 354 812 827 92 51 818